Eco-friendly Firm Launches Kickstarter For New Line
Wabi Sabi Eco Fashion Concept is launching via Kickstarter to offer it’s new organic fabrics and styles.We recently connected with founder Michele Helene Cohen to learn more; here is what she told us:
What is the social benefit you hope to achieve with or through your crowdfunding campaign?
Wabi Sabi Eco Fashion Concept uses only the best organic materials. That means we help to protect not only the environment but also the health and wellbeing of consumer as well as textile industry workers through the globe. We only work with skilled artisan craftsmen who create luxury quality products but work in a safe environment where they are paid fair wages.
How much money are you hoping to raise and why? How much have you raised so far?
We are hoping to raise $15,ooo dollars in order to go into production of our first signature collection called “sustainable City Style”. We also have stretch goals. If we reach $35,000 We can offer three more color options for the woven styles. If we reach $70,000 we can offer extended sizes.Our current sizes run from US 0 to 8. If we reach our stretch goal of $70,000 we will be able to expand the size offering including petites.
To date we have already raised 20% of our funding goal and we still have 24 days of the campaign left to go!
Whom are you trying to help with your project and why?
Fashion is one of the most contaminating industries. By helping to reduce this we are creating a better, safer and healthier planet for all.
What rewards, if any, are you offering to your supporters?
First of all we offer a selection of of dresses from this collection at a reduced price. We also have a t-shirt for just $25, a handmade gold jelwery set and then some fun rewards su ch a private photo shoot, a private trunk show partym or backers can even help us to design a product.
